Email short for electronic mail as it is send over the Internet.
Two kind of programs, the ones installed on your computer, like MS Outlook and Thunderbird(many more out there) or you send them online, that is straight from a website you log in to it on line with your email name and password. You can use them from any computer that goes on the internet.
The envelope with address is the header of the email, so your computer knows where it is going and how to get there.
How can you see that header? That of course is different for every program and you can find the solution here:
http://128.175.24.251/headers.htm or try the eater help http://forum.419eater.com/forum/viewtopic.php?t=118787

That's a lot of rubbish to go through to find out where it came from, so what, we have a computer that can do that.
Open up a new tab and load "http://headertool.apelord.com/headers" or make a bookmark and run it from there.
Enter the rubbish they call a header there and click.
You get something like this.
IP Address Probable Country Whois Google DNS stuff urgentmessage.org
207.229.52.99 Canada (Pincher Creek)*
63.127.11.68 United States (Eden Prairie)* Whois Google DNS stuff urgentmessage.org

3.5.2.0 United States* Whois Google DNS stuff urgentmessage.org
* The last IP listed is usually the originating IP address
we'll do the Whois Google DNS stuff urgentmessage.org stuff later here, if I don't forget it

The last IP# is the IP# were the email originated and it seems in this case that it was an online email program that
doesn't show the IP# of the sender, but just the IP# of the email1 server.

There are lots of website that can find out where that IP# came from, they don't all agree, but that's because they claim
they have the best database, what else is new.
Some I use.
http://www.geobytes.com/IpLocator.htm?GetLocation
http://www.ip-adress.com/ip_tracer/
http://whatismyipaddress.com/staticpages/index.php/lookup-ip
http://www.komar.org/cgi-bin/ip_to_country.pl
and there are many more. Now you have an idea where your friend might be, not that it helps much, it's usually out of
the country you're in, so you're safe if your email program can't show him the same info.
When you use Gmail/Hushmail/Fast mail online they will not show your computer IP# to your friends so they have no way
to figure out where you are. If you set those email accounts up with all fake info, a nice baiter name(not related to
your eater name or anything from Real Life), there's no way they can ever figure out where or who you are.

Okay as promissed, the Whois or "who is" will tell you a bit more about the ISP that's providing the IP#, it's usually
their headquarters so in this case it has nothing to do with me as my ISP rents a line from them and Burnaby is a long days ride
from my home.
The Google tab should be clear, eh
The DNS stuff is just DNS stuff, tells you a bit more about the ISP of my ISP and the name of my ISP that's it.
urgentmessage.org was a website/database of a former eater member who had the skills to set up a way to search endless
scam emails and extract valuable data out of them, like names, IP#, email addresses and telephone numbers so you could
look up what else your friend had been up to, where that phone number was used before, simply link data together so you
got an idea how that man worked, what his game was and how long he had been at it. I will miss this very much!
